Vintage Fire Truck Up for Auction to Support Essential Equipment for Portsmouth Fire Department

Trucker Talk RadioBy Trucker Talk RadioApril 18, 2025No Comments1 Min Read
Vintage fire truck up for auction to support essential equipment
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

The Portsmouth Fire Department is holding an online auction for a 1989 Maxim Pumper fire truck through municibid.com. The auction is open to everyone and will conclude on January 27. Residents of Rhode Island have the opportunity to bid at any time during the auction period.

This classic fire truck has a mileage of 80,883 miles and is equipped with a Detroit diesel engine, automatic transmission, and a robust 1500 GPM pump. It received an upgrade in 2005, and it is reported to be in good working condition, both in terms of driving and braking. Additionally, it features a Westerbeke diesel generator, which provides power for hydraulic rescue equipment such as cutters and spreaders.

Screenshot

All proceeds from this auction will directly benefit the Portsmouth Fire Department, with plans to purchase essential supplies such as water hoses and helmets, along with possibly investing in new vehicles in the future.

Currently, the highest bid stands at $2,500, but it has yet to meet the reserve price. To ensure fairness, the auction may receive a two-minute extension to deter last-minute bids.
